An 01 RX300 had 220hp and a four speed transmission. The 08-09 RX350
has 270hp and a five speed transmission. Unless you're getting the V8
Pathfinder, the power should be comparable. What's your definition of
off-roading? The Lexus will excel in luxury for on-road driving
compared to any truck-based vehicle; the Murano would be a closer
vehicle to the RX. Even so, the viscous limited slip center diff AWD
system of the RX is very capable, though it lacks the 2-speed transfer
case, trans holder/descent controls, and ground clearance for true off-
roading which the Pathfinder has.
Drive both vehicles and think about where you'll be driving it most of
the time.
